In the movie Wolf (1994), Will Randall, a renowned publisher, undergoes a transformative experience when he becomes a werewolf. Faced with this supernatural condition, he not only has to come to terms with his new abilities but also grapples with the challenges they present. As he tries to keep his job and assert his authority in his profession, he becomes entangled in a gripping fight for survival.

As the film progresses, viewers are taken on a thrilling journey into the unknown, where the line between man and beast blurs. As the wolf within him grows stronger, Will must navigate the delicate balance between his primal instincts and his human consciousness. Caught in a web of intrigue and danger, he must discover the true nature of those around him, as allegiances shift and secrets are revealed.

Wolf intricately weaves together elements of horror, drama, and suspense. It explores themes of identity, power, and the primal forces that lie within us all. With its compelling storyline and standout performances, the movie keeps audiences on the edge of their seats from start to finish.

Directed by Mike Nichols and featuring an all-star cast including Jack Nicholson, Michelle Pfeiffer, and James Spader, Wolf offers an unforgettable cinematic experience.
